Biological Activity
Biotin is conjugated to the surface of biomacromolecules via chemical or enzymatic methods, and the tetrameric structure of avidin is utilized to achieve cascade amplification of detection signals, which significantly improves the detection sensitivity of trace molecules. In addition, with the aid of streptavidin-based solid-phase carriers, this technology can also achieve precise capture and purification of target molecules, or serve as a targeting ligand to guide the enrichment of drugs at lesion sites. Biotin modification is the cornerstone of modern molecular diagnostics, proteomics, and targeted therapy.
